Application process

Only students nominated by their home institutions can apply for the exchange programme. Once you have been nominated, you need to fill out our application form and return it before 15th June to start in Semester 1 and 15th October for Semester 2.

You will receive a decision on your application within 4-6 weeks of submission. Once accepted you will receive your Welcome Pack and student ID by email. You can also apply for on-campus accommodation at this stage. On-campus accommodation is not guaranteed for exchange students but you may apply for it. Our Accommodation Team can also advise you on finding off-campus accommodation. For more information about accommodation please visit the Accommodation page.

Frequently asked questions

Courses

Students are allowed to change their courses in the first two weeks of the semester, provided they have the pre-requisites for the course they would like to take and that there is availability on the course. You should inform your home institution of the changes in your course selection.

Workload

Workload at Heriot-Watt University
Study PeriodHeriot-Watt CreditsNo. of ECTS Credits
Per Course157.5
Per Semester6030
Per Academic Year12060

The workload of a full time student is 60 Heriot-Watt credits per semester, equivalent to 4 courses (15 Heriot-Watt credits per course). Students are expected to put in effort of 150 hours per course, including teaching hours.

Courses (or components) usually consist of two hours lecture and one hour tutorial. However, each course and component is different so please discuss with the course leader or your mentor for more details. Students have to sign up for tutorials at the start of each semester (Please refer to the information provided on Canvas for each course).
